<!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>We are Prep Hoops Indiana have been hard at work getting through our prospect rankings updates. After debuting the Class of 2026 rankings and updating our Class of 2025 rankings, this week we have turned our attention to the Class of 2024. If you haven't already, make sure you <a href="https://prephoops.com/2023/01/class-of-2024-prospect-rankings-2/">take a look at the revamped rankings</a> that feature a Top 150 plus over 100 additional names on our Watch List. In this article we will be highlighting six prospects who made their debuts in our updated rankings. These "new names" have continued working hard at their games and made the necessary improvements to catch our eye and shoot up into the Class of 2024 Top 150. This will be Part One of a two part series highlighting our new names.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>[player_tooltip player_id='1287890' first='Noah' last='Lovan'] (Providence H.S.): Lovan is a bigger guard with great physical tools and strength. He has immediately stepped into a major scoring role for the defending Class 2A state champions after transferring in from across the river. The 6'3" guard makes his debut in the Prep Hoops Indiana Class of 2024 rankings at #45 overall. Lovan is one of the better players down in southern Indiana and definitely will be a candidate to continue rising up our rankings.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>[player_tooltip player_id='1761698' first='Sam' last='Mlagan'] (Bethesda Christian H.S.): Mlagan is one of the best guards in the greater Indianapolis area that you may not have heard of yet. The shifty, athletic guard is averaging 16.6 points per game to lead Bethesda Christian to a 12-2 record and a Top 5 ranking in Class 1A. He is excellent off of the dribble and creates his own shot consistently with a smooth mid-range jumper. In this rankings update, Mlagan made his debut at #101 in the Class of 2024.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>[player_tooltip player_id='1761697' first='Malachi' last='McNair'] (Evansville Harrison H.S.): This 6'5" post player has emerged as a go-to threat for Evansville Harrison this season. McNair is flirting with a double-double every time out with averages of 14.4 points and 9.4 rebounds per game. He has excellent strength around the basket, good footwork, and the skill level to finish consistently. He broke into our Class of 2024 Prospect Rankings at #82 overall in this most recent update.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>[player_tooltip player_id='1761728' first='Zach' last='Meeks'] (Cathedral H.S.): While he will likely end up playing Division I football at the next level, this move-in to Cathedral is pretty solid on the basketball court as well. At 6'7" with all of the physical tools you could want, Meeks has played a valuable back-up role for the defending Class 4A state Championship. Meeks is an excellent defender and rebounder who will not get pushed around by anyone on the floor. Ranked #91 overall in the Class of 2024 Prospect Rankings.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>[player_tooltip player_id='1547566' first='Coryell' last='Spates'] (Pike H.S.): If you are looking for an elite catch-and-shoot threat, look no further than this junior guard at Pike High School. Spates is shooting over 50% from three-point range this season on nearly four attempts per game. He has broken out this season as the fourth leading scorer on a very talented Red Devils squad that is having a lot of success. His debut in the Class of 2024 Prospect Rankings comes at #88 overall.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>[player_tooltip player_id='1578400' first='Izaak' last='Wright'] (Wabash H.S.): This 6'2" left-handed guard is having an a breakout junior season for 12-4 Wabash. Wright is averaging 18.4 points and 7.3 rebounds per game while shooting 44-97 from beyond the arc. He has a sweet left-handed stroke with a quick release and the ability to attack closeouts in a straight line. In this recent Prep Hoops Indiana Class of 2024 Prospect Rankings update Wright made his debut at #80 overall.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ph -->
